New Havan unit in Garibaldi boosts the economy of Serra Gaúcha, expands the retailer’s presence in Southern Brazil, and accelerates an ambitious plan to reach 200 megastores by the end of 2026

Havan will further expand its presence in Rio Grande do Sul with the opening of a new megastore in Garibaldi, a city in Serra Gaúcha with about 34,000 inhabitants. The unit, built along the BR-470, received an investment of R$ 90 million, is expected to have a strong regional economic impact, and already has a confirmed opening date: June 6, 2026, at 10 am. According to information released by the portal ND Mais, businessman Luciano Hang will personally attend the inauguration of the network’s 193rd branch in Brazil.

The retailer’s arrival in the city comes at a strategic moment for the company, which will celebrate 40 years of operation in 2026 and is accelerating an aggressive national expansion plan. Furthermore, the new operation promises to transform the commercial landscape of the region by creating 200 direct jobs and increasing the economic flow between Garibaldi and Bento Gonçalves.

The future unit also reinforces Havan’s advancement in the South of the country, especially in Rio Grande do Sul, a state that already hosts dozens of the brand’s operations. As published by ND Mais, this will be the company’s 22nd megastore in the state.

Havan megastore in Garibaldi will have 10,000 square meters and more than 350,000 products

The new Havan structure in Garibaldi stands out for its size and strategic location. Built near the border with Bento Gonçalves, along the BR-470, the unit will have about 10,000 square meters of total area.

The space will feature free parking, diverse sectors, and approximately 350,000 items available for consumers. Among the visual highlights of the new store is the traditional Statue of Liberty, a trademark of the retail chain throughout Brazil.

In addition to the commercial impact, the opening is expected to significantly increase the flow of visitors in the region, considered one of the main tourist and economic hubs of Serra Gaúcha.

In a statement released by the company, Luciano Hang highlighted the brand’s historical relationship with Rio Grande do Sul.

“In these four decades, we have expanded throughout almost all of Brazil, and Rio Grande do Sul has always welcomed us with open arms,” said the businessman.

Million-dollar investment strengthens local economy and creates 200 new jobs

The construction of the new megastore represents one of the largest recent private investments in the Garibaldi region. In total, R$ 90 million were invested in the project, a value that includes structural works, logistics, equipment, and operational preparation.

Additionally, the opening of the unit created 200 new direct job opportunities, boosting the local job market and expanding opportunities for residents of Serra Gaúcha.

Retail sector specialists point out that large commercial enterprises tend to cause significant indirect effects, including increased consumption, real estate appreciation, and strengthening of surrounding commerce.

Another important factor is the store’s location on a strategic state highway. The BR-470 is considered one of the main logistical corridors in Rio Grande do Sul, connecting industrial, tourist, and agricultural municipalities.

In this sense, the expectation is that the new unit will attract consumers from different cities in the region, further strengthening the local economy.

Havan accelerates expansion and aims to reach 200 megastores by the end of 2026

The opening of the Garibaldi unit is part of a national expansion plan by Havan. The company aims to reach the historic mark of 200 megastores by the end of 2026, expanding its presence in all regions of the country.

In Rio Grande do Sul, other operations are also underway. One of the most anticipated is the Taquara unit, scheduled to open on May 30, 2026.

According to the ND Mais report, the Taquara structure received an investment of approximately R$ 100 million and will feature 11,000 square meters of built area.

The complex will also have four movie theaters operated by Cine Gracher, with a capacity of up to 135 people per session, expanding the concept of shopping and entertainment center of the network.

Meanwhile, another megastore is also planned for Tramandaí, on the coast of Rio Grande do Sul, reinforcing the company’s strategy to consolidate its presence in regions considered strategic for economic and tourist growth.

With the upcoming opening in Garibaldi, the expectation now revolves around the regional impact of the new unit, which is expected to boost jobs, attract consumers from various cities, and further consolidate Havan’s expansion in the South of Brazil.
